Selecting a DNC increase

You can adjust the DNC increase, i.e. the sensitivity of the increase in volume and sound, in five increments.

The setting "DNC 1" is suitable for vehicles with loud engines and bass-loaded music. The setting "DNC 5" is suitable for vehicles with quiet engines and for classical music. You will need to test various settings to find the most suitable one for your taste.

To select a DNC increase,

￿press and hold the AUDIO button : for longer than two seconds.

￿Press the softkey 5 with the display label "DNC".

￿Press the softkey 5 with the display label "LEVEL".

￿Adjust the increase using the joystick

8.

￿Press the OK joystick 8or the AUDIO button :to exit the menu.

The settings are saved.

Subwoofer and centre speaker

You can connect a subwoofer and a centre speaker to this device.

To further optimise the sound when using a subwoofer and centre speaker, you can ad- just a low-pass filter for the subwoofer and one high-pass filter each for front and rear.

Adjusting the subwoofer increase

You can adjust a permanent volume in- crease or decrease for the connected sub- woofer from -6 to +6 and thereby increase or decrease the bass response of the sub- woofer. The setting to be selected depends upon the installation position and installa- tion location of the subwoofer in your vehi- cle. You may need to test various settings to find the most suitable one for your taste.

￿Press the AUDIO button :. "AUDIO MENU" appears on the display.

￿Press the softkey 5 with the display label "SUBOUT".

￿Press the softkey 5 with the display label "GAIN".

￿Move the joystick 8up or right to in- crease the level or down or left to de- crease the level.

When you have finished making your chang- es,

￿press the OK joystick 8or the AUDIO button :.
